Is metal fencing expensive?
Metal fencing can be an expensive investment, but it is also a durable and long-lasting option. Unlike wood fencing, metal fencing will not rot or succumb to insect damage. It is also resistant to weathering and will not fade or warp over time. In addition, metal fencing is easy to maintain and can be easily cleaned with a power washer. As a result, metal fencing is a popular choice for homeowners who are looking for a low-maintenance fence option. However, metal fencing can be more expensive than other types of fencing, such as wood or vinyl. Therefore, it is important to factor in the initial cost of the fence as well as the long-term costs of maintenance before making a decision.

Does metal fencing rust?
Metal fencing is a popular choice for both residential and commercial properties. It is durable and low-maintenance, and it can be customized to suit any aesthetic. However, one common question about metal fencing is whether it rusts. The answer is that metal fencing can rust, but it is not inevitable. There are many types of metal fencing on the market, and each has its own level of resistance to rust. For example, galvanized steel fencing is treated with a layer of zinc that helps to prevent rusting. If metal fencing does begin to rust, there are a number of products available that can help to stop the spread of corrosion, such as Hammerite metal paint spray. In most cases, metal fencing is a great choice for properties that need a low-maintenance, long-lasting solution.
How long does metal fencing last?
Metal fencing is a popular choice for both residential and commercial properties. It is known for its durability, and many metal fences are designed to last for decades. However, the lifespan of a metal fence will depend on a number of factors, including the type of metal used and the climate. For example, aluminum fences are less likely to rust than those made from iron, and they can withstand extremes of temperature without warping or cracking. In general, metal fences require very little maintenance, and even when exposed to harsh weather conditions, they will continue to look good for many years.
The key to longevity is to keep the metal clean and free of rust. Regular cleaning with a mild detergent will remove dirt and grime, and help to prevent rust from forming. If rust does form, it’s important to remove it as soon as possible to prevent further damage. In addition, metal fencing should be inspected regularly for any signs of wear or damage. With proper care, metal fencing can last for decades, providing homeowners with a beautiful, low-maintenance boundary for their property.
Do metal fence posts need concrete?
If you’re installing a metal fence, you might be wondering if you need to set the posts in concrete. The answer depends on the type of metal fencing you’re using. For example, chain link fencing can be installed without concrete, while wrought iron fencing will need concrete for support. In general, metal fencing that is subject to high winds or other forces will need to be set in concrete. This will help to ensure that the fence stays in place and doesn’t topple over. However, metal fencing that is less likely to be affected by wind or other forces can be installed without concrete. Ultimately, it’s important to enquire with the manufacturer, or a professional, before installation to ensure that your fence is installed correctly.
Can metal fence posts be reused?
Most metal fence posts can be reused. This is especially true for posts made of aluminum or steel. However, posts made of iron may be more difficult to remove if they are fixed into concrete, plus may not be as strong if they are reused. If you are planning to reuse metal fence posts, it is important to inspect them for damage before attempting to remove them from the ground. How to install metal fencing.
Metal fencing is a great way to add security and privacy to your property. But before you can enjoy the benefits of metal fencing, you need to install it correctly. Here are some tips on how to install metal fencing:
1. Measure & Mark:
First, you need to identify where you want your fencing to go, then carefully measure the distance between the fence panels & mark the corners with metal posts.
2. Dig your holes:
Next, you need to dig holes for the metal posts to sit in. Make sure the holes are wide enough and deep enough to support the posts. A general rule of thumb is to make sure at least a third of the fence post is in the ground to ensure the post is stable.
3. Add your concrete:
Once you have dug your holes, you need to position your fence post in the hole. You will need a second person to hold the fence post in position, making sure the fence post is level & upright in all directions. Next, use a bag of quick setting concrete, such as Hanson’s post mix, to fix the post into the ground. Make sure you follow the instructions on the packaging to ensure you fix the post in securely.
Repeat this process with the remaining fence posts, making sure to check the distances between fence posts before setting them in with concrete. There is nothing worse than fixing your fence posts into the ground, to find out your fence panel won’t fit in the gap!
4. Attach your metal fence panels:
Once the metal posts are in place, you can start attaching the metal fence panels. To do this, simply line up the panels with the posts and use the screws or bolts provided to secure them in place.
5. Add the finishing touches:
Finally, once all the panels are attached, you can add any finishing touches like trim or paint. And that’s it! Now you know how to install metal fencing.
